Definition and Scope of Safety Valves
Safety valves are essential devices in various industrial processes, designed to release pressure automatically when it exceeds safe levels, protecting equipment and personnel from potential hazards. They are widely used across industries to ensure the safe handling of gases and fluids under high pressure.
Market Drivers
Increased Demand from the Oil & Gas Sector: As oil & gas exploration activities continue to rise in North America, safety valves are in high demand for preventing over-pressurization incidents in pipelines and other equipment.
Growing Investments in Power Generation: The energy & power sector’s shift towards safer and more efficient power plants, including nuclear and renewable power facilities, is driving the demand for advanced safety valves.
Expanding Applications in Water and Wastewater Treatment: Safety valves play a vital role in water treatment plants, ensuring smooth operation under high pressure and preventing leaks or contamination.
Market Restraints
High Cost of Advanced Materials: Safety valves made with specialty materials like cryogenic alloys can be costly, potentially limiting adoption in cost-sensitive industries.
Maintenance and Operational Challenges: Regular maintenance is necessary for optimal performance, and any malfunction can result in significant operational costs or downtime.
